 | I was really confused today in science class today on your lesson about compounds. I thought compounds were two words put together to form a new word out of those two words. You know...paper and clip to make paperclip. |  |
|
 | Well, you sort of got it. Compounds like your learning about in science class are when at least 2 different elements combine together to make a new substance. |  |
